r/budgetprojectors • Can't decide on a budget projector ->I have used a few year old model (Mogo 2) and the picture quality is surprisingly good! In terms of Netflix availability it depends on the model. With Mogo 2 you would have to use Desktop Launcher to get the app or use a TV stick. I just use my phone and Airplay/Chromecast from Netflix. Nevertheless, XGIMi has just released Mogo 2 (New) which now supports Netflix again.
